[QUOTE="ossagp, post: 192812, member: 1650"] Differences in rake, trail, and balance as well as more subtle things like swingarm angle, countershaft sprocket relationship to the swingarm, suspension and basic frame architecture all have a bearing on whether you will be steering any particular bike with the front or the back. the axle position makes a big difference to me. It isn't as simple as the monthlies like to make it sound sometimes. If you ever saw a dirttrack race of about any kind you see that the cars typically are partially sideways in a power slide. that is one kind of steering with the back. it is hard to imagine a dirttrack without that type of turning action.
